#7b9f9e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7b9f9e is composed of 48.2% red, 62.4%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 0.6% yellow and 37.6% black. It has a hue angle of 178.3 degrees, a saturation of 15.8% and a lightness of 55.3%. #7b9f9e color hex could be obtained by blending #f6ffff with #003f3d.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#7b9f9e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030404 is the darkest color, while #f8fafa is the lightest one.

Tones of #7b9f9e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8d8d is the less saturated color, while #23f7f1 is the most saturated one.
